Нелинейность

Нелинейность модели с интерполяционными таблицами, аппроксимируйте математические функции путем отображения входных значений с выходными значениями

Если вы плохо знакомы с моделированием нелинейности, сначала попытайтесь использовать блок интерполяционной таблицы. Интерполяционная таблица блокирует массивы использования данных, чтобы сопоставить входные значения с выходными значениями, аппроксимируя математические функции. Чтобы аппроксимировать функцию в переменных N, используйте блок n-D Lookup Table:

Блоки

1-D Lookup TableАппроксимируйте одномерную функцию
2-D Lookup TableАппроксимируйте двумерную функцию
Direct Lookup Table (n-D)Индексируйте в n-мерную таблицу, чтобы получить элемент, вектор или 2D матрицу
Interpolation Using PrelookupИспользуйте предварительно вычисленный индекс и дробные значения, чтобы ускорить приближение N-мерной функции
Lookup Table DynamicАппроксимируйте одномерную функцию с помощью динамической таблицы
n-D Lookup TableАппроксимируйте n-мерную функцию
PrelookupВычислите индекс и часть для блока Interpolation Using Prelookup
Sine, CosineРеализуйте синус фиксированной точки или волну косинуса использование подхода интерполяционной таблицы, который использует симметрию волны четверти

Классы

Simulink.LookupTableСохраните и совместно используйте интерполяционную таблицу и установите точки останова данные, сконфигурируйте данные для ASAP2 и генерации кода AUTOSAR
Simulink.BreakpointСохраните и осуществляйте обмен данными для набора точки останова, сконфигурируйте данные для ASAP2 и генерации кода AUTOSAR
Simulink.lookuptable.EvenspacingСконфигурируйте даже данные о наборе интервала для объекта интерполяционной таблицы
Simulink.lookuptable.TableСконфигурируйте табличные данные для объекта интерполяционной таблицы
Simulink.lookuptable.BreakpointСконфигурируйте данные о наборе точки останова для объекта интерполяционной таблицы
Simulink.lookuptable.StructTypeInfoСконфигурируйте настройки для типа структуры тот объект интерполяционной таблицы использование в сгенерированном коде

Примеры и руководства

Введите табличные данные и точки останова

Задайте наборы данных точки останова и табличные данные для блоков интерполяционной таблицы.

Отредактируйте интерполяционные таблицы

Измените элементы интерполяционных таблиц.

Импортируйте данные об интерполяционной таблице из MATLAB

Вы можете таблица импорта и устанавливать точки останова данные из переменных в рабочем пространстве MATLAB путем ссылки на них во вкладке Table and Breakpoints диалогового окна.

Импортируйте данные об интерполяционной таблице от Excel

Импортируйте данные в интерполяционную таблицу с xlsread функция.

Создайте интерполяционную таблицу логарифма

Работа с блоками интерполяционной таблицы.

Предварительный поиск и блоки интерполяции

Используйте Prelookup, и Interpolation Using Prelookup блокируется вместе.

Обновите блоки интерполяционной таблицы к новым версиям

Обновите существующие модели, чтобы использовать текущие версии блоков интерполяционной таблицы.

Оптимизируйте сгенерированный код для блоков интерполяционной таблицы

Оптимизируйте сгенерированный код для блоков интерполяционной таблицы.

Просмотрите данные об интерполяционной таблице

Работа с интерполяционной таблицей возражает со средством просмотра интерполяционной таблицы.

Концепции

О блоках интерполяционной таблицы

Блок интерполяционной таблицы использует массив данных, чтобы сопоставить входные значения с выходными значениями, аппроксимируя математическую функцию.

Анатомия интерполяционной таблицы

Установите точки останова наборы данных, и табличные данные являются компонентами интерполяционной таблицы.

Библиотека блоков интерполяционных таблиц

Выберите среди различных блоков в библиотеке Lookup Tables.

Инструкции для выбора интерполяционной таблицы

Выберите лучшую интерполяционную таблицу для своего приложения.

Характеристики данных об интерполяционной таблице

Выполните требования к данным интерполяционной таблицы и представляйте прерывистые данные.

Методы для аппроксимации значений функции

Установите метод, которым интерполяционная таблица блокирует аппроксимированные значения функции.

Рекомендуемые примеры